Increased by 175%, the number of 24 becomes what?

Respuesta :

audgee
audgee audgee
  • 19-10-2020

Answer:

66

Step-by-step explanation:

increase the number by 175% of its value.

percentage increase = 175% × 24

new value =

24 + percentage increase =

24 + (175% × 24) =

24 + 175% × 24 =

(1 + 175%) × 24 =

(100% + 175%) × 24 =

275% × 24 =

275 ÷ 100 × 24 =

275 × 24 ÷ 100 =

6,600 ÷ 100 =

66
